MUZAFFARABAD: Pakistan Muslim League-N (PMLN) bagged three seats and its ally Jamat-e-Islami (JI) got one seat while the Pakistan People’s Party (PPP) also secured one seat in the election of five women special seats. The 41 newly elected members of AJK Legislative Assembly cast their votes in AJK Assembly lodging hall here on Friday for five special seats of women and elected their respective candidates. As per the details, from PMLN Sehrish Qamar, Faiza Imitiaz and Nasema Wani, from JI Refat Aziz and from PPP Shazia Akber got seven votes each respectively and were declared successful. Whereas, the joint candidate of Muslim Conference and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f, Mehrun Nisa of got five and Nabila Irshad of JKPP got one vote and were unable to get the representation in AJK legislative Assembly. The PPP interestingly won the one women seat despite having just three votes and got three votes from PML-N and one from Independent in their favor. Thus the strength of AJK Legislative Assembly completed with 49 seats including three unopposed reserve seats.
